    Hello. Sorry if this question has been answered before, but I was looking to at a 3 in suspension lift to my automatic 2.7liter 2004 pre runner along with 33 in tires. I know that it is a bad idea, so here is my new question. Can I add 285/ 16 or 17,s with no lift. The guy at 4 wheels parts said yes, but I don’t know if I can trust him, he was ready for me to pay before I even looked at wheels. I don’t want to add any performance enhancer like air filters etc, just some wheels and tires.Any help? Some may say dump it and get a 4*4 V6, I intended to, but my dad just died of covid and this was his truck, so it is sentimental to me. Thank you.

    265/70r16 work flawlessly on stock rims. You have to match rim offsets to get the same results with custom rims.
    285 will rub under full compression on 16"+17" rims.
    Do not lift over 2.5" if it's to be a daily driver.
